Vascular origin in acute transient visual disturbance: A prospective study

Summary
A new clinical score effectively predicts vascular causes of transient visual disturbances (TVDs). This tool aids in diagnosing TVDs, potentially streamlining neurovascular evaluations when ophthalmologic assessments are delayed.

Background:
- Transient visual disturbances (TVDs) can indicate serious underlying vascular conditions.
- Accurate and timely diagnosis of TVDs is crucial for appropriate patient management.
- Current diagnostic methods may have limitations in rapidly identifying the origin of TVDs.
Purpose of the Study:
- To validate a clinical score for predicting the vascular origin of TVDs in patients presenting without diplopia.
- To assess the score's performance in distinguishing ischemic TVDs from nonvascular causes.
- To determine the score's utility in guiding neurovascular evaluation.
Main Methods:
- Prospective study involving patients in an ophthalmology emergency department and a transient ischemic attack (TIA) clinic.
- Clinical evaluation included a tailored questionnaire, brain, vascular, and ophthalmologic investigations.
- A nine-point clinical score was derived and externally validated in an independent cohort.
Main Results:
- An ischemic origin for TVDs was identified in 45% of the derivation cohort.
- The nine-point score demonstrated good discriminative power (c-statistic = 0.82) in identifying ischemic origin.
- The score was successfully replicated in the validation cohort (c-statistic = 0.75), with a score ≥ 4 showing 85% sensitivity and 52% specificity.
Conclusions:
- The developed clinical score can assist in predicting the vascular origin of transient visual disturbances.
- Ophthalmologic evaluation, while important, should not delay essential neurovascular assessment if not immediately available.
- The findings support the use of this score in clinical practice for managing patients with TVDs.
